what engine? are you sure it is the HVAC fan? did you open the hood and feel the box?
the late 80's I6 engines had a cooling fan on the engine by the intake, if i'm not mistaken they ran after the truck shut off.

You both have the 4.9. It's the engine after run cool down fan. That's what they call it. I have it.
